If you’re in a hurry to switch jobs, you’re likely to find yourself in another job you dislike as much as your current one. How can you apply for the job you actually want and not just what’s available? Find Your Dream Job guest Ebony Joyce says you start by slowing down. Figure out what it is you want and what’s holding you back. Ebony also warns against lateral moves, as that can affect your lifetime earning potential. Ebony stresses the importance of knowing your values and finding a company with similar values.  About Our Guest: Ebony Joyce (https://www.linkedin.com/in/ebonyjoyce/) is a job search strategist, speaker, and diversity and inclusion consultant at Next Level Career Services.
